A2Z TREE SERVICE is a federal contractor, registered under UEI Y5J3CSLG3LD8. It has been awarded $450,881 across 7 federal contracts. Primary work spans Landscaping Services and Support Activities for Forestry. Top awarding agencies include Department Of The Interior, Department Of Agriculture, and Department Of Defense.

Invasive Treatment Services - Blue Springs Creek Conservation Area
Solicitation # MDC 0000000216SL
The contract is for invasive species treatment services at the Blue Springs Creek Conservation Area in Crawford County, Missouri, focusing on the removal of privet (Ligustrum spp.) across multiple acreage units totaling up to 1,000 acres under the original contract period, with options to renew for two additional one-year periods. The work requires cutting all privet stems taller than three feet at the base and treating each stump with a 50% aquatic-rated glyphosate solution containing indicator dye within five minutes of cutting, ensuring stump height does not exceed six inches. Diesel fuel is strictly prohibited as a carrier, and all vegetation waste must be kept out of the stream channel. Work is restricted to conditions above 32°F, excluding dry ground and the spring flush period between leaf emergence and full leaf-out, and contractors must post maps of active work zones to accommodate hunting activities. Performance is site-specific, with inspections occurring on-location and final acceptance processed administratively at the Missouri Department of Conservation’s office in Villa Ridge, Missouri. The solicitation, issued under MDC 0000000216SL and classified under NAICS 561730, is open to state-level vendors and evaluated using a lowest and best bid methodology, where price carries the highest weight at a maximum of 200 points, but non-price factors such as participation with Organizations for the Blind or Sheltered Workshops can add up to 15 bonus points and state preference for Missouri-produced goods may serve as a tiebreaker. Contractors must demonstrate responsibility, comply with Missouri statutes including E-Verify enrollment and business entity registration, and adhere to stringent specifications on herbicide use, waste disposal, and seasonal work limitations. The contract includes a non-appropriation clause, making funding contingent on legislative approval, and prohibits assignment without written consent. Subcontractors require prior approval and must meet all prime contractor obligations. Key requirements include signing confidentiality agreements, maintaining organizational conflict of interest protocols, and submitting monthly reports on participation with qualified nonprofit organizations. Proposals are due by August 17, 2026, and must be submitted electronically through MissouriBUYS; failure to submit required certifications such as Secretary of State registration, E-Verify documentation, or affidavits of work authorization will render a bid non-responsive. Payment is processed via invoice submission to the designated remittance address, with funds disbursed through a statewide financial management system.

Snow Plowing and Ice Management in Bangor, ME
Solicitation # snow-plowing-ice-management-bangor-me
Arbor E&T dba EQUUS Workforce Solutions is soliciting quotes from licensed and insured providers for comprehensive snow plowing and ice management services at the Penobscot Job Corps Center in Bangor, Maine. The contract period runs from October 15, 2026, through April 30, 2027, with the possibility of annual renewal upon mutual written agreement. The scope of work includes clearing the primary road, parking lot, and sidewalks to bare pavement, with services triggered at 4.0 inches of accumulation. All primary areas must be clear by 6:00 AM on weekdays, weekends, and holidays, and courtesy clears are required every 4 inches during ongoing storms. The contractor is responsible for providing all necessary equipment and materials, including plow trucks and premium rock salt. Qualified bidders must submit their quotes via email to David Landry by 12:00 Noon on Friday, September 4, 2026. The contractor must maintain at least 1,000,000 dollars in Commercial General Liability insurance and provide a Certificate of Insurance before work begins. Key requirements include a joint pre-season walk-through by October 15, 2026, to document existing property damage, as the contractor assumes full liability for any damage caused to turf, curbs, pavement, or landscaping during operations. Safety standards require the use of high-visibility vests and vehicle strobe lights. This solicitation is open to various small business set-asides, including SDB, WOSB, HUBZone, and SDVOSB.

RFQ5901 Grass Mowing Services
Solicitation # 5901
Management & Training Corporation (MTC) is seeking bids for a subcontracting opportunity to provide comprehensive grass mowing and grounds maintenance services at the San Diego Job Corps Center in Imperial Beach, California. The scope of work includes bi-weekly mowing of designated areas, irrigation system maintenance and repair, hedge trimming in the interior courtyard, weed abatement using approved herbicides, seasonal fall cleanup, and the off-center disposal of all debris. The contract consists of a base period from August 24, 2026, through January 31, 2027, with two subsequent one-year option periods extending through January 31, 2029. This is a small business set-aside opportunity under NAICS code 561730. Award selection is not based on the lowest price but on a combination of fee-for-service pricing, experience in contracted mowing services, and a history of providing services in residential or institutional settings. Mandatory pass/fail requirements include the submission of a completed MTC Supplier Packet, a current Certificate of Insurance, and applicable corporate or Department of Labor approvals. Contractors must be licensed in the State of California and comply with Service Contract Labor Standards, specifically Wage Determination 2015-5635 (MOD 29). Administrative requirements include weekly or bi-weekly invoicing and strict adherence to safety and regulatory standards, including OSHA and the Drug-Free Workplace Act. Subcontractors must maintain significant insurance coverage, including general liability of at least 1 million dollars per occurrence and worker's compensation with employer's liability of 500,000 dollars. Additionally, the contractor must comply with federal records management policies and strict PII encryption and breach notification protocols, requiring any suspected data breaches to be reported to the DOL within one hour of discovery.
